improve the setcc -> setcc_carry optimization to happen more
consistently by moving it out of lowering into dag combine. Add some missing patterns for matching away extended versions of setcc_c. git-svn-id: https://llvm.org/svn/llvm-project/llvm/trunk@122201 91177308-0d34-0410-b5e6-96231b3b80d8

+// Optimize RES = X86ISD::SETCC CONDCODE, EFLAG_INPUT
+static SDValue PerformSETCCCombine(SDNode *N, SelectionDAG &DAG) {
+ unsigned X86CC = N->getConstantOperandVal(0);
+ SDValue EFLAG = N->getOperand(1);
+ DebugLoc DL = N->getDebugLoc();
+
+ // Materialize "setb reg" as "sbb reg,reg", since it can be extended without
+ // a zext and produces an all-ones bit which is more useful than 0/1 in some
+ // cases.
+ if (X86CC == X86::COND_B)
+ return DAG.getNode(ISD::AND, DL, MVT::i8,
+ DAG.getNode(X86ISD::SETCC_CARRY, DL, MVT::i8,
+ DAG.getConstant(X86CC, MVT::i8), EFLAG),
+ DAG.getConstant(1, MVT::i8));
+
+ return SDValue();
+}
